Services d'animation Promas Inc. is a Québec-based cultural animation company located in Sainte-Catherine-de-la-Jacques-Cartier. The company designs and operates immersive guided tours, street theatre, and thematic packages that bring New France history and local heritage to life. Its offerings include historical guided walks, theatrical street performances, Halloween specials, cyclorama presentations, and combined evening packages that pair guided tours with stage shows.
Promas works with costumed interpreters and performers to present narratives about colonial life, historical crimes, funeral rites, and seasonal traditions. Notable experiences listed include Visite animée – Mort en Nouvelle-France, Théâtre de rue – Crimes en Nouvelle‑France, Cyclorama de Jérusalem, and seasonal productions such as Noël en Nouvelle‑France and Halloween-themed productions. Some packages combine storytelling with mentalism and ghost-themed theatre.
The operation serves visitors to Old Québec and surrounding heritage sites by providing structured routes, scripted performances, and audience participation elements. Programs emphasize factual storytelling, period costume interpretation, and site-specific staging.
